首页 文章

如何为Angular Material paginator自定义css?

提问于
浏览
0

我想修改Angular Material Paginator的默认外观 . 例如,我想将justify-content属性更改为flex-start .

.mat-paginator-container {
display: flex;
align-items: center;
justify-content: flex-end;
min-height: 56px;
padding: 0 8px;
flex-wrap: wrap-reverse;
width: 100%;}

我做的是 - 我在styles.css文件中粘贴了下面的CSS

.mat-paginator-container {
display: flex;
align-items: center;
justify-content: flex-start;
min-height: 56px;
padding: 0 8px;
flex-wrap: wrap-reverse;
width: 100%;}

但那没用 . 我也在组件的css文件中尝试了css . 但那也行不通 . 那我怎么修改css呢?

UPDATE

事实证明我必须使用!重要而且它有效!我正在避免这种情况,但别无选择 . 任何更好的解决方案,请告诉我 .

1 回答

  • 0

    你可以使用:: ng-deep来改变mat-paginator的风格

    :host ::ng-deep.paginator .mat-paginator-container{
      justify-content: flex-start;
    }
    

相关问题